'He would get corruption done': Swati Maliwal targets Kejriwal after Satyendar Jain's arrest
Swati Maliwal targets Kejriwal over DJB, liquor scams

NEW DELHI: Rajya Sabha member Swati Maliwal on Wednesday accused former Delhi chief minister Arvind Kejriwal of presiding over a decade of corruption in the national capital, alleging irregularities in projects including classroom construction and the liquor policy.“In last 10 years in Delhi, Arvind Kejriwal was running a shop of corruption, be it construction of classrooms, liquor scam, they did many of such scams,” BJP leader Maliwal said.Maliwal alleged that Kejriwal deliberately kept himself away from ministerial portfolios and allowed corruption to be carried out through ministers, whom he later blamed when allegations surfaced.“Arvind Kejriwal functioned cleverly, he did not handle any of the ministry, he would get the corruption done through the minister, and then when the minister used to be exposed, he would blame the minister,” Maliwal added.She also alleged that Aam Aadmi Party leader Satyendar Jain was acting as a “collection agent” for the party in Punjab.“Now the STP scam of the DJB that came to the fore, it is a very serious scam, because the STPs are important aspect of Yamuna cleaning. Satyendar Jain is acting as a collection agent for AAP in Punjab,” Maliwal said.AAP leader and former Delhi minister Satyendar Jain was arrested in connection with alleged corruption in the Delhi Jal Board, an official told news agency ANI.The Delhi government’s Anti-Corruption Branch (ACB) has arrested six people in the case, including former Delhi Jal Board CEO Udit Prakash Rai, former contractual consultant Ankit Srivastava and three private individuals — Nagendra Yadav, Raja Kumar Kurra and Pankaj Verma.The arrests were made in connection with an FIR registered by the ACB on May 11, 2024, under provisions of the Prevention of Corruption Act and the Indian Penal Code. The case includes charges related to bribery, criminal breach of trust, cheating and criminal conspiracy.The FIR was registered on a complaint by the Directorate of Vigilance, GNCTD, alleging large-scale irregularities, manipulation of tender conditions and criminal conspiracy in the tendering process for the augmentation and upgradation of sewage treatment plants (STPs) of the Delhi Jal Board.AAP chief and former Delhi CM Arvind Kejriwal attacked the BJP over Jain’s arrest, saying his party colleague was arrested on the “BJP’s behest”.‘Part of witch-hunt’, says AAP leader AtishiAam Aadmi Party (AAP) leader Atishi on Wednesday also alleged that the arrest of former Delhi minister Satyendar Jain was part of a BJP conspiracy and “witch-hunt”.“The arrest of Aam Aadmi Party leader Satyendar Jain is part of a BJP conspiracy and ‘witch-hunt’. On one hand, there is the BJP, which is perpetrating one scam after another in Delhi, yet no action is being taken against them,” Atishi said.
